our story

CocoAndré is a Mexican-American family-owned chocolate shop located in Oak Cliff, Texas. Andrea and Cindy’s entrepreneurial journey began nearly 15 years ago after both experienced unexpected layoffs. With less than $1,000 between them, they transformed a challenge into an opportunity, creating a chocolate shop that honors their heritage, culture, and identity as Mexican-American Texan mothers.

For Andrea and Cindy, CocoAndré is about more than chocolate—it’s about family and connection. Cindy shares, “We want you to feel the love of home when you come through our doors.”

Andrea’s journey started in the 1980s when she took a part-time job at Dallas’ first chocolate shop. Her passion and dedication led to a 25-year career as a master chocolatier and head of production. Along the way, she became deeply inspired to explore her Mexican roots in cacao, blending her expertise with her heritage.

Cindy, meanwhile, was thriving in the construction industry, learning the intricacies of business operations, budgets, and team management. But when the economic downturn in 2009 left her unemployed, she joined forces with her mother to create CocoAndré. Cindy envisioned a space where Andrea’s unmatched talent as a chocolatier could flourish as an owner, not just an employee. Together, they turned a dream into reality, building a company that has become a symbol of resilience and creativity.

Today, CocoAndré is renowned for producing some of the finest hand-crafted chocolate delights, serving loyal customers from their quaint Oak Cliff shop to fans across America. Andrea, Cindy, and their dedicated team lovingly craft chocolates that create sweet memories to last a lifetime.

Our
Process

Rooted in their Mexican heritage, Andrea and Cindy infuse tradition and artistry into every creation. CocoAndré’s signature molded chocolates include whimsical designs like high-heeled shoes, pan dulce shapes, and piñatas—each a nod to their culture and creativity.

The cacao used in their creations is sourced directly from Soconusco, Chiapas, where the trees trace back to Mayan culture and a 3,500-year-old history. Andrea and Cindy work directly with female farmers, ensuring ethical practices and honoring the legacy of cacao cultivation. Their visits to the cacaotales (cacao groves) inspired a deep appreciation for the history and passion behind this extraordinary ingredient.
